Overview
EN 3381:2025 is a European standard developed by the European Committee for Standardization (CEN) for aerospace screws. This standard specifies the characteristics of screws with:
- 100° countersunk normal head
- Offset cruciform recess drive
- Close tolerance normal shank and short thread
- Manufactured in titanium alloy, anodized, and lubricated with molybdenum disulphide (MoS₂)
The screws are classified at a minimum tensile strength of 1 100 MPa at ambient temperature and up to a maximum temperature of 315°C. EN 3381:2025 ensures uniformity in critical aerospace fasteners, providing industry-wide confidence in performance, reliability, and safety.
Key Topics
- Screw Configuration: Defines requirements for the 100° countersunk head, offset cruciform recess, short threaded shank, and close tolerances necessary for aerospace applications.
- Materials and Surface Treatments: Specifies titanium alloy as the base material, with anodizing for enhanced corrosion resistance and MoS₂ lubrication for improved wear and reduced friction.
- Mechanical Performance: Classification at 1 100 MPa tensile strength and service temperature up to 315°C addresses demanding aerospace requirements.
- Dimensional Standards and Marking: Links screw dimensions and tolerances to ISO 5856, ISO 7913, and relevant marking as per EN 2424.
- Quality Management: Manufacturers must comply with a recognized quality management system, such as EN 9100, and meet qualification procedures for aerospace products.
- Oversized Bolts: Guidance is provided for the use of oversized bolts according to EN 4016.

European foreword
This document (EN 3381:2025) has been prepared by ASD-STAN.
After enquiries and votes carried out in accordance with the rules of this Association, this document has
received the approval of the National Associations and the Official Services of the member countries of
ASD-STAN, prior to its presentation to CEN.
This European Standard shall be given the status of a national standard, either by publication of an
identical text or by endorsement, at the latest by April 2026, and conflicting national standards shall be
withdrawn at the latest by April 2026.
Attention is drawn to the possibility that some of the elements of this document may be the subject of
patent rights. CEN shall not be held responsible for identifying any or all such patent rights.
This document supersedes EN 3381:1996.
This document includes the following significant technical changes with respect to EN 3381:1996:
— editorially updated;
— Clause 3 “Terms and definitions” added;
— SAE AMS4967 added;
— Table 3 “Drive Codes” updated;
— 7.2 “Quality management system” updated;
— 7.3 “Qualification of screws” updated.
